Why is this role important?

DesignOps is the orchestration and optimization of tools and processes in order to amplify design’s value and impact at scale. The DesignOps Manager is accountable for improving how the Experience Design team coordinates work, executes work, and maintains work.

You will be working directly with the Head of Experience Design to establish the right systems to connect the Digital Strategy & Products design and product groups, and to ensure there’s a working system connecting these activities with the rest of the organization.

You will work closely with the Digital Strategy & Products Process Director to align the system design to enable the designers work more efficiently on a daily basis. As well, you will be working in partnership with others Design Leads in the Experience Design group, as well as other design managers across CBC and Radio-Canada.

Success is measured through the continually improving quality, velocity, and capabilities of the design practice.

How you will make an impact:

You will have the leading role in establishing the DesignOps practices with CBC's growing digital design team.
​By clarifying and coordinating design processes, systems and tools; you will enable the digital teams to create higher-quality, and more relevant audience experiences.
You will strengthen inclusive, cross-team relationships throughout the CBC by raising awareness of the Experience Design team's goals and methods.
